Output 51e98fa9e867f2ede8c00ad9e4838fe9fbeeec3b76a55b4ccc56041da3b3d4a4:0

value
492862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40e86e3ae9f9d11e5e81248ce07062446a0750e OP_EQUAL
address
3J74xRMeGQq1xa2JoPucYBvb4Gi7CsYuc5
transaction
51e98fa9e867f2ede8c00ad9e4838fe9fbeeec3b76a55b4ccc56041da3b3d4a4
confirmations
164685
spent
true